Might Terraform Mars – And What Would It Involve

The prospect of terraforming the red world – transforming it into a habitable environment for people – remains a captivating possibility. However, the hurdles are immense, and the price tag staggering. Initial steps, like thickening the gaseous layer and raising the heat , could involve deploying massive reflectors in orbit to melt frozen gas and produce a greenhouse effect . Subsequently, introducing microbes to create oxygen and grow a basic environment would represent a further, equally involved phase. Estimates for a complete terraforming undertaking range wildly, from trillions to possibly quadrillions of currency units and taking centuries, if not millennia , to achieve . Even partial terraforming efforts, such as creating self-contained domes , would still require a considerable investment.

Teleportation – The Possibilities and Paradoxes

Consider a world where science entertainment relocation is instantaneous: teleportation. The hypothetical breakthrough presents incredible opportunities , from transforming worldwide trade to enabling instantaneous humanitarian response . However, this concept is riddled with complex issues . Would the system involve disassembling a person at a fundamental level and reassembling them elsewhere, effectively creating a copy while destroying the original individual? Such raises profound ethical inquiries about identity , consciousness, and very nature of existence . Moreover , potential for abuse – from producing clones to transporting hazardous materials – demands careful evaluation before pursuing such a revolutionary endeavor .
